Output 89fd6707ce93abf4ff8afea13c50cb0539e78bb195d0c607251b938bccada066:29

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 ccef66f595cd7656a535c2928de6817a05197327
address
tb1qenhkdav4e4m9dff4c2fgme5p0gz3jue8whmn4p
transaction
89fd6707ce93abf4ff8afea13c50cb0539e78bb195d0c607251b938bccada066
confirmations
58090
spent
true